如何在云服务器上运行软件

fiy 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在云服务器上运行软件是现代化的云计算应用方案之一。下面是一个关于如何在云服务器上运行软件的简单指南。

    第一步:选择合适的云服务提供商
    在选择云服务提供商时,你应该考虑以下几个方面:

    • 服务可用性和稳定性:确保云服务提供商有高可用性和稳定的基础设施。
    • 服务可扩展性:确保云服务提供商能够根据你的需求进行扩展,并提供合适的资源。
    • 价格和性能:比较不同云服务提供商的价格和性能,并选择最适合你的需求的方案。

    第二步:选择合适的云服务器实例类型
    云服务器提供不同的实例类型,包括共享实例、独占实例和GPU实例等。你需要根据你的应用要求选择适合的实例类型。

    • 共享实例:适用于低负载的应用,因为多个用户共享同一个物理服务器,性能可能会受到其他用户影响。
    • 独占实例:适用于有较高性能需求的应用,因为每个用户独占一个物理服务器,性能稳定。
    • GPU实例:适用于需要进行大规模计算的应用,因为GPU实例提供了更高的计算性能。

    第三步:安装操作系统和软件
    在云服务器上安装操作系统和软件的过程与在物理服务器上类似。你可以选择在云服务器上安装自己喜欢的操作系统,如Ubuntu、CentOS等。然后,你可以使用包管理器(如apt-get、yum等)安装你所需要的软件。

    你也可以使用配置管理工具(如Ansible、Chef等)来自动化安装和配置软件的过程。

    第四步:配置网络和安全
    在你的云服务器上运行软件之前,你需要配置网络和安全设置,以确保你的软件正常运行并得到保护。

    首先,你需要分配一个静态IP地址给你的云服务器,这样你的软件就能够通过该IP地址进行访问。

    其次,你需要设置防火墙规则,以控制进出云服务器的网络流量。你可以使用云服务提供商的防火墙工具来配置规则,并只允许特定的IP地址或IP范围访问你的云服务器。

    最后,你可以考虑设置安全组,以进一步限制进出你的云服务器的网络流量。安全组可以根据不同的安全需求定义规则,如只允许特定的协议和端口通过。

    第五步:运行软件
    一旦你完成了操作系统和软件的安装、网络和安全的配置,你就可以开始在云服务器上运行你的软件了。

    你可以通过命令行或图形界面来操作你的云服务器,并运行你的软件。你可以使用管理工具(如SSH、Web控制台等)远程连接到你的云服务器,并启动你的软件。

    同时,你可以使用监控工具(如Zabbix、Prometheus等)来监控你的云服务器和软件的性能和健康状况。

    总结
    在云服务器上运行软件需要按照一系列步骤来完成。首先,你需要选择合适的云服务提供商和云服务器实例类型。其次,你需要安装操作系统和软件,并配置网络和安全设置。最后,你可以启动你的软件,并使用监控工具来监控性能和健康状况。希望这个简单指南可以帮助你在云服务器上成功运行软件。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在云服务器上运行软件是一种越来越普遍的做法,它提供了弹性和可扩展性,可以满足不同规模的应用需求。下面是在云服务器上运行软件的一些步骤和注意事项。

    1.选择云服务提供商:首先,你需要选择一个适合你的云服务提供商。市场上有很多不同的云服务提供商,比如亚马逊AWS,Microsoft Azure,Google Cloud等。你需要考虑因素包括价格、可用性、服务水平协议(SLA)等。

    2.选择云服务器实例:一旦选择了云服务提供商,你需要选择合适的云服务器实例。这取决于你的软件需求,包括处理能力、内存、存储空间等。云服务提供商通常提供了各种不同规格的实例,可以根据你的需求进行选择。

    3.配置云服务器:在选择了云服务器实例后,你需要配置服务器。这包括设置操作系统、安全组、存储卷等。你可以选择不同的操作系统,比如Linux和Windows,根据你的软件的要求进行选择。你还可以设置防火墙规则、安全组策略来保护你的服务器。

    4.安装软件:一旦你的云服务器配置好了,你可以开始安装你的软件。这通常涉及到下载并安装你的软件包,配置必要的设置和参数。你可以使用命令行工具或者图形界面工具来进行软件安装和配置。

    5.监控和管理:在你的软件运行在云服务器上之后,你需要监控和管理服务器的性能和运行状态。云服务提供商通常提供了监控工具,可以帮助你监控服务器的CPU使用率、内存利用率、网络流量等。你还可以使用日志管理工具来收集和分析服务器的日志。

    总结起来,在云服务器上运行软件需要选择合适的云服务提供商和服务器实例,配置服务器并安装软件,以及监控和管理服务器的性能和运行状态。这些步骤可以帮助你顺利地在云服务器上运行软件。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在云服务器上运行软件可以带来许多好处,比如可灵活扩展计算资源、提高系统的可靠性和安全性等。下面是在云服务器上运行软件的详细步骤。

    1. 选择云服务提供商:首先需要选择一个云服务提供商,如AWS、Azure、阿里云等。根据自己的需求和预算选择合适的云服务商。

    2. 创建云服务器实例:登录云服务提供商的控制台,创建一个云服务器实例。在创建实例时,需要选择合适的实例类型、操作系统、存储和网络配置等。根据软件的需求选择合适的配置。

    3. 连接到云服务器:一旦实例创建成功,就可以通过SSH、RDP等远程连接协议连接到云服务器。具体连接方式和凭证信息会在创建实例时提供。

    4. 更新系统软件:连接到云服务器后,首先要更新操作系统上的软件包。使用适当的包管理工具,如apt、yum等,执行更新命令,保持系统的安全性和稳定性。

    5. 安装依赖库和软件:根据软件的要求,安装所需的依赖库和软件。可以使用包管理工具来安装,也可以手动下载和安装。

    6. 配置环境变量:某些软件可能需要配置环境变量。编辑相应的配置文件,添加或修改环境变量的值。

    7. 设置防火墙规则:为了保护云服务器的安全,需要配置防火墙规则。根据软件的需求打开相应的端口,允许特定的网络流量通过。

    8. 启动软件:完成以上步骤后,就可以启动软件了。使用命令行或图形界面来启动软件,根据软件的要求进行相应的配置和操作。

    9. 监控和调优:在运行软件的过程中,及时监控服务器的资源使用情况,如CPU、内存、磁盘和网络等。如果发现资源不足或性能问题,可以进行相应的优化和调整。

    10. 备份和恢复:为了防止数据丢失或系统故障,定期进行备份。同时,准备好恢复策略和工具,以便在需要时能够快速恢复。

    总结:
    在云服务器上运行软件可以通过选择云服务提供商、创建云服务器实例、连接到云服务器、更新系统软件、安装依赖库和软件、配置环境变量、设置防火墙规则、启动软件、监控和调优、备份和恢复等步骤来完成。不同的软件可能需要额外的步骤和配置,具体根据软件的要求来操作。

    这些步骤的具体细节和操作流程可能会有所差异,具体的实施过程应根据云服务提供商和所使用的软件来进行调整。同时,在运行软件的过程中,及时备份数据、监控系统性能、更新版本等也是非常重要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部